About 57,600 results
Open links in new tab
  1. Microgrid - Wikipedia

    Microgrid Knowledge defines a microgrid as a "self-sufficient energy system that serves a discrete geographic footprint, such as a college campus, hospital complex, business center or neighborhood."

  2. In terms of microgrid design, this means that the microgrid does not have to be built to serve power 24/7, but instead can be built to provide power during times the main electric grid experiences an outage …

  3. What are Microgrids? Definition, How They Work, and Reliability ...

    Dec 4, 2025 · What is a microgrid? A microgrid, in short, is a localized energy system that can operate independently or in connection with the main electric grid.

  4. What is a microgrid? - IBM

    Microgrids are small-scale power grids that operate independently to generate electricity for a localized area, such as a university campus, hospital complex, military base or geographical region.

  5. Microgrids: What are they and how do they work? - EnergySage

    Dec 6, 2023 · In practice, a microgrid works in the exact same way, just for a smaller geographic area, like a couple of buildings or a local community. To meet the electricity demands of its users, a …

  6. An Introduction to Microgrid Systems — Mayfield Renewables

    Nov 12, 2025 · In this case, our microgrid includes solar PV (generation), BESS (storage), a grid isolation device (islanding), and two groups of loads (primary backup and sheddable loads).

  7. An Introduction to Microgrids: Benefits, Components, and Applications ...

    Microgrids are small-scale power systems that have the potential to revolutionize the way we generate, store, and distribute energy. They offer a flexible and scalable solution that can provide communities …

  8. Microgrids | Schneider Electric United States

    A microgrid is a self-contained electrical network that can operate either connected to the utility grid or in an independent “island” mode. This capability allows you to generate your own electricity on-site and …

  9. Review on the Microgrid Concept, Structures, Components ... - MDPI

    Jan 1, 2023 · This paper provides a comprehensive overview of the microgrid (MG) concept, including its definitions, challenges, advantages, components, structures, communication systems, and control …

  10. Microgrid Technology: What Is It and How It Works? - Vertiv

    Jul 10, 2023 · Generally, a microgrid is a set of distributed energy systems (DES) operating dependently or independently of a larger utility grid, providing flexible local power to improve reliability while …